Mecha BREAK is a multiplayer mech combat game with co-op and battle royale

Developer Seasun Games revealed their upcoming multiplayer mech game,Mecha BREAK. Players can customize their own diverse mechs and appearances before taking on colossal war machines across various treacherous terrain types.Mecha BREAKfeatures a 3v3 Arena Mode, a 6v6 Battlefield Mode, and a 48-player Battle Royale Mode. There’s also a co-op mode where players can form teams of three or six to take on specialized combat missions. Narrative FPS Industria 2 challenges an alternate dimension malevolent AI in 2025

Developer Bleakmill and publisher Headup have announced thatIndustria 2will take players on yet another dimension-hopping journey when the narrative FPS launches on PC next year. 2021’sIndustriasaw players fall through dimensions on the evening of the Berlin Wall’s fall, attempting to find their missing colleague while solving a mystery across time and space. It’s a short but rich narrative first-person shooter with puzzle elements, and its sequel sounds like it’s sticking to the original’s formula....

Paradox and Fatshark team up again for War of the Vikings

Beards! Fatshark is applying theWar of the Rosesframework to a related — but standalone, it should be pointed out — combat game calledWar of the Vikings. Yes, the name pretty much says it all. You in? Skirmishes will take place during ninth- and tenth-century England with support for up to 64 players at once. There’s also talk of a Pitched Arena mode where 32 players fight without respawns. Those hardcore modes are always so tense....
